Midjourney
Midjourney

Description: Midjourney is an AI-powered image generation tool. It allows users to create stunning visual art by simply describing what they want to see. Midjourney generates highly-detailed images based on the text prompts provided by users.

Key Features Comparison

Midjourney
Midjourney Features
  • Text-to-image generation
  • Ability to iterate on images through conversational prompts
  • Integration with Discord for easy sharing and collaboration
  • Large model architecture for high-quality outputs
Microsoft Designer
Microsoft Designer Features
  • Vector drawing tools
  • Image tracing
  • Typography tools
  • Creative effects
  • Integration with Microsoft Office

Pros & Cons Analysis

Midjourney
Midjourney
Pros
  • Intuitive and easy to use
  • Produces impressive, creative images from text prompts
  • Active Discord community for feedback and inspiration
  • Affordable subscription-based pricing
Cons
  • Limited free tier
  • Potential for AI bias and problematic content
  • Images not always perfect on first try
  • Legal uncertainties around image rights
Microsoft Designer
Microsoft Designer
Pros
  • Powerful vector tools
  • Intuitive interface
  • Affordable
  • Seamless Office integration
Cons
  • Limited third-party plugin support
  • Not as feature-rich as Adobe Illustrator
